Measure Your Wall Studs Before Ordering
The backs of the shelves are routed for standard stud spacing. This allows the brackets to hit studs that are 16” apart on center (from the center of one stud to the center of the next stud). These routs allow the shelf to sit flush against the wall. Some homes have studs that are spaced differently.
It is very important that you confirm your stud placement before placing your order.

Shelf Appearance Can Vary
Like any standard wood furniture, shelves are sometimes made of more than one piece of wood glued together to obtain a particular depth. This prevents warping or bowing of deeper shelves.
Often there will be varying grain patterns and character on each shelf. There will be times when the different pieces of wood used take the torching and/or stains differently, based on the grain pattern.
All natural grain patterns may vary from shelf to shelf. Please see examples of this in the product pictures. They are each unique and beautiful, so your Made To Order shelves are truly one of a kind!
